Medical research and clinical guidance regarding prostate cancer have focused on improving early detection and personalizing treatment strategies.

Researchers at Moffitt Cancer Center and Oxford University have developed mathematical biomarkers, such as the Adaptive Therapy Score (AT Score) and Expected Time to Progression (eTTP), to assist in adaptive therapy. This approach uses data from routine prostate-specific antigen (PSA) blood tests to help physicians determine when to pause or restart treatment, aiming to slow the growth of drug-resistant cells.

In parallel, medical experts emphasize the necessity of early screening to identify the disease before symptoms like urinary discomfort or bone pain emerge. While the PSA test remains a primary diagnostic tool, recent innovations are directed toward more precise tumor identification and individualized care to improve patient outcomes.
